1. Live Surgery Is the Only Way to Gain Real Surgical Confidence

Placing implants on real patients is completely different from working on models, pig jaws, or watching demonstrations. Real tissue, real bone density, real bleeding, real anatomical variations—nothing else comes close.

With live implant surgery, you learn:

  • How soft tissue behaves during flap design
  • How bone density changes your drilling sequence
  • How to manage unexpected findings
  • How to adjust angulation in real time
  • How to communicate with your surgical assistant
  • How to solve problems during the procedure
These real-world variables are impossible to simulate with models or virtual systems.

The result?

You leave the course confident—not just knowledgeable.

7. Live Training Helps You Improve Restorative Skills Too

Implant dentistry is not only about surgery—it’s about restoration.
Live surgery courses teach both components.

You learn:

  • How depth and angulation affect prosthetics
  • Platform positioning for ideal emergence profiles
  • Timing for temporaries
  • Impression techniques
  • Digital workflows for crowns and bridges
Understanding both sides of implantology makes you a better clinician overall.
